Self-regulating Cutting Rotation CNC Mills

To significantly boost efficiency and reduce personnel involvement, many modern CNC mills now feature automated tool changing (ATC) systems. These advanced mechanisms allow the tooling center to swiftly switch between different cutters without requiring manual intervention. This not only minimizes downtime between jobs but also enables the creation of complex parts utilizing a wider range of shapes. Some sophisticated changers even incorporate pallet systems, capable of holding a large quantity of tools and further streamlining the production process. The investment in an ATC CNC machine often yields a considerable return through reduced labor costs and increased output.
